Abstract:Purpose
Globally, the cord care practices contribute to neonatal infections and account for a large proportion of neonatal deaths annually, especially in low-income countries. This study has been provoked by the absence of previous similar research in this locality. The study aimed at exploring and highlighting the factors and practices in the community that influence umbilical cord care to identify the areas of intervention.
